10 2026 Movies That Could Make $1 Billion, Ranked By Likelihood

Next year, 2026, is shaping up to be a huge year for movie theaters, with several films expected to earn over a billion dollars globally. While 2025 saw some big hits like A Minecraft Movie, Superman, and Jurassic World Rebirth, only three films have actually reached the billion-dollar milestone so far this year.

Disney’s recent live-action Lilo & Stitch and Zootopia 2 both earned over $1 billion at the box office, and Ne Zha 2 became a massive hit, taking in over $2 billion worldwide. Avatar: Fire and Ash is expected to join them, potentially giving 2025 four movies that each grossed over $1 billion. However, 2026 looks even more promising and could surpass that number.

2026 is set to be a big year for movies, with new installments planned for major franchises like Star Wars, Marvel, and Toy Story. We can also expect exciting films from well-known directors such as Christopher Nolan and Denis Villeneuve. Several of these movies have the potential to earn over $1 billion at the box office, though some are more likely to reach that milestone than others. Here’s a ranking of the 10 films most likely to cross the $1 billion mark in 2026.

10. Dune: Part 3 – 25%

Dune: Part Three continues the epic story started in Denis Villeneuve’s previous films, showing Paul Atreides gaining power on the desert planet Arrakis. The first two movies were excellent versions of Frank Herbert’s classic 1965 science fiction novel, combining impressive directing with stunning visuals. With the second film doing so well, the third installment has the potential to be even more popular.

The movie Dune, released in 2021, made $429.5 million around the world, even though it was available to stream at the same time as its theatrical release. Its sequel, Dune: Part 2, released in 2023, did even better, earning $714.8 million because it was shown only in theaters. While a third movie should continue the success of the series, it’s unlikely to reach $1 billion in total earnings.

While the Dune movies have been popular with both critics and viewers, the novel Dune: Messiah – which the next film is based on – explores some strange and unsettling themes. Director Villeneuve will probably adjust the story to make it easier to follow, but the resulting film might not have the large-scale action that most people expect.

Despite dealing with complicated stories and dark subject matter, the first two Dune movies resonated with viewers and performed well in theaters. This suggests there’s a solid fanbase that could make Dune: Part Three a success, particularly if people can experience it in a high-quality format.

9. Minions 3 – 30%

As a huge animation fan, I remember when Despicable Me came out in 2010 – it really launched something special! It’s incredible to think that franchise is now the highest-grossing animated series ever, having made $5.6 billion around the world. While I love Gru and his family, it’s the Minions who’ve really captured everyone’s hearts. They’ve become total icons, and their own movies have been massive hits too!

Currently, only two movies in the Despicable Me franchise have earned more than $1 billion at the box office: Minions (2015) and Despicable Me 3 (2017). Although the Minions films are still well-liked, recent releases are seeing slightly lower ticket sales. Both Minions: The Rise of Gru and Despicable Me 4 earned over $900 million globally, but didn’t quite reach the $1 billion milestone.

While Minions 3 is expected to do well, particularly with kids, and likely earn enough for a sequel, it probably won’t reach $1 billion at the box office, judging by the performance of the previous two movies.

8. Michael – 38%

Musical biopics have had varying levels of success in theaters. While Bohemian Rhapsody proved how popular these films can be, earning over $910 million globally, not all have reached that same height. Films like Elvis and A Complete Unknown did reasonably well, but others, including Better Man and Deliver Me From Nowhere, struggled to attract audiences.

What really makes the documentary Michael compelling is its subject. Michael Jackson was, without a doubt, one of the biggest artists of all time, reaching global fame that made him instantly recognizable everywhere. Even with all the controversies surrounding him, his music still resonates with people today, and that’s something the film really explores.

The first trailer suggests the Michael movie will be more than just a film – it’s designed to be a full concert experience, letting fans hear his music with incredible sound in a theater and learn about his life and career. While Bohemian Rhapsody was a huge success, Michael Jackson could potentially top it. However, it’s unlikely the movie will easily reach $1 billion at the box office.

7. The Mandalorian and Grogu – 42%

For the first time since 2019’s The Rise of Skywalker, a Star Wars movie is coming back to theaters. This new film features The Mandalorian and Grogu, continuing their story from the first three seasons of the Disney+ series. It’s difficult to predict how well this movie will perform at the box office, though.

The Star Wars franchise has consistently been a huge success in theaters around the world. Each of the three sequel films made over $1 billion, and The Force Awakens even surpassed $2 billion. Rogue One also reached the $1 billion mark, though Solo showed that not every Star Wars movie is a guaranteed hit.

The success of the Mandalorian and Grogu movie likely hinges on whether it can attract people who aren’t already fans of the show. A lot of viewers only watch the main Star Wars films and skip the spin-offs. Still, the characters – especially Grogu – are incredibly popular, and that popularity could be enough to push the movie past the $1 billion mark.

6. The Odyssey – 56%

Christopher Nolan has become a brand name in filmmaking. People will see his movies simply because he directed them, trusting he’ll deliver a great experience – as proven by the huge success of films like Oppenheimer, which earned nearly $1 billion worldwide despite being a long, mature-rated movie. He’s already directed two films that grossed over a billion dollars – The Dark Knight and The Dark Knight Rises – and his new film, The Odyssey, has the potential to make it a third.

The upcoming film, The Odyssey, is based on the classic Greek story by Homer and features a remarkable cast including Tom Holland, Matt Damon, Anne Hathaway, and many other stars. Although it won’t be released until July 17, 2026, early projections suggest it will perform well in theaters.

Tickets for Christopher Nolan’s The Odyssey in 70mm IMAX became available a year before the movie even came out, and they quickly sold out. There’s a lot of excitement for the film, particularly the opportunity to experience it in the highest quality possible. Though it might not ride the wave of the “Barbenheimer” phenomenon, The Odyssey is well-positioned to become another billion-dollar success for Nolan.

5. Moana – 78%

Since its release in 2016, Moana has continued to be a huge hit. Nielsen reports it was the most-streamed movie in both 2023 and 2024, and this lasting popularity helped its sequel, Moana 2, earn over $1 billion at the global box office.

Disney is already planning to build on the popularity of Moana with a live-action movie coming out in 2026. Considering how well the original film did, this remake could easily earn over $1 billion, although Disney’s live-action remakes haven’t always been successful.

Despite the disappointing performance of Snow White in 2025, Lilo & Stitch became a huge success, earning over a billion dollars and demonstrating continued interest in these types of movies. Even though the original Moana is less than a decade old, its strong performance both in cinemas and on streaming platforms suggests its upcoming remake will be very profitable.

4. Toy Story 5 – 86%

Toy Story 3 was a groundbreaking success, becoming the first animated movie to earn $1 billion globally. While it felt like a fitting end to the story, Pixar decided to make Toy Story 4. That turned out to be a smart decision, as the fourth film also earned over $1 billion, even surpassing the box office numbers of the third movie.

While some fans believe the Toy Story series ran its course after the third film, Toy Story 5 is expected to be another success for Pixar. Following the disappointing performance of Elio, Pixar is counting on both Hoppers and Toy Story 5 to regain momentum in 2026. Although Hoppers‘ potential is uncertain, a new Toy Story movie with Woody and Buzz is almost sure to be a hit.

Recent Disney/Pixar animated sequels, such as Zootopia 2 and Inside Out 2, have been huge successes at the box office, both earning over $1 billion. While Toy Story 5 is also expected to reach that milestone, its release is just two weeks before the next Minions movie, which could impact its potential earnings.

3. The Super Mario Galaxy Movie – 90%

Mario is a well-known character loved by people of all ages. He’s famous for his video games, but now you can also find him at theme parks and in movies. The 2023 Super Mario Bros. Movie was a huge success, earning $1.36 billion around the world and becoming one of the highest-grossing animated films ever made.

The next movie in the series will explore brand new worlds, drawing inspiration from the Super Mario Galaxy games. With the addition of popular characters like Yoshi, Rosalina, and Bowser Jr., The Super Mario Galaxy Movie is expected to earn over $1 billion worldwide and potentially surpass the box office success of the first film.

2. Spider-Man: Brand New Day – 90%

Spider-Man is the most commercially successful superhero of all time, and his latest movie was a huge hit. No Way Home earned $1.9 billion globally, almost reaching the $2 billion mark. It’s the second Spider-Man movie within the Marvel Cinematic Universe to earn over $1 billion, following Far From Home, which achieved this in 2019.

Although “Brand New Day” won’t likely be a Spider-Man team-up movie featuring Tobey Maguire and Andrew Garfield, Tom Holland’s fourth film as Spider-Man is still predicted to be very successful. Spider-Man movies consistently perform well in theaters, and the addition of Mark Ruffalo as the Hulk and Jon Bernthal as the Punisher is building even more anticipation.

1. Avengers: Doomsday – 90%

While Marvel movies haven’t been as consistently successful at the box office since Avengers: Endgame, the upcoming Doomsday is expected to be a huge success, likely earning over $1 billion worldwide. Marvel’s team-up events usually do very well, and Doomsday could be their biggest one yet.

The new movie will feature a team-up of five iconic groups: The Avengers, the Thunderbolts, the Fantastic Four, the Wakandans, and the X-Men. They’ll be facing off against Doctor Doom, portrayed by Robert Downey Jr., and his motivations remain a secret. This story is part of a larger, multiversal narrative that is expected to lead into the events of Secret Wars.

The movie’s cast just got even bigger with the news that Chris Evans will reprise his role as Steve Rogers. While it might not make as much money as Infinity War and Endgame, Doomsday is still expected to be a huge box office success and could be the year’s highest-grossing film in 2026.
